Abstract

Accretion of ice along the wing leading edge can pose a serious threat to aircraft safety. Thermal anti-icing systems are commonly used to prevent ice formation along the wings. University of Toronto Institute for Aerospace Studies has initiated a research project in developing a generic wing anti-icing control and simulations system. As part of this research initiative this thesis presents the development of a dynamic model of an anti-icing system using a system identification based approach, and an investigation of the sensitivity of the system to changes in the control parameters and location of the temperature sensor. The results of this sensitivity analysis were used in tuning the controller and finding an optimum location for the feedback temperature sensor. This study indicates that the system identification approach is an effective tool for modeling dynamic systems based on test data for the purposes of controller sensitivity analysis and tuning.
